Play h264 stream in browser. The goal is to Direct Play all media.

Play h264 stream in browser com under multimedia, in the Video section, other browsers have H. Contribute to vladmandic/stream-rtsp development by creating an account on GitHub. 264 encoding/decoding transformation stage using WebCodecs. This works because Edge already supports hevc but doesn't report it. 264 codec built in. If playback fails in one browser, try installing a different one from the Google Play Store that explicitly mentions H. However Chromium doesn't. The result is always an empty frame. Which method to choose? Maybe Flash helps? In this video, we'll walk you through the process of streaming RTSP H. Jul 24, 2018 · View H. May 29, 2024 · I am trying to set up human detection on an IPTV security camera I have, and the access point is only through the browser because an official application is not yet available on Linux. Older versions of Edge don't support playback of H. 5 from Blackmagic’s support page, plug your Mini Recorder into the computer’s thunderbolt port, and attach your SDI or HDMI source to the device. but I can barely find a example for h264. I installed Chromium with brew cask. Is there a way to get this working? P. I noticed when I signed in I am unable to see the camera feed and to my understanding it’s because I am using H. Dec 18, 2016 · Hi, i want to play raw-h264 stream in browser, now i can get it in js by websocket, but i don't know how to play it, i know broadway can do it, but i don't know how to do it, can you give me some s. 264-encoded video from an IP camera to the browser, while supporting all common browsers and mobile devices (i. Nov 28, 2023 · This can be because you don’t have the latest version of the Microsoft Edge browser installed. 264 playback error. Feb 16, 2020 · currently in the new Edge its not possible to play videos in HEVC format, neither watch pictures in HEIC format. Looking for a solution. Basically ffmpeg captures the screen and produces h. 264. Check your browser's WebRTC codec support, focusing on H. How to play rtsp stream in browser directly - simply and no plugins! Streamedian presents HTML5 RTSP streaming video player over WebSocket for working with video on the web. One of the best is IPCamLive. 265 in Chrome and other browsers for better video compression. Many open source projects are there that will do the work of RTSP to HTTP conversion or you can use FFmpeg (used by VLC) to convert RTSP to HTTP and then can stream it on the browser. WonderFox HD Video Converter Factory Pro is not only a powerful multimedia player supporting all kinds of video files including H264 encoded videos, but also a versatile converter supporting more than 600+ files format and devices, such as MP4, AVI, MKV May 28, 2025 · Wondering why Chrome cannot play HEVC video? Read this post to learn about Chrome HEVC support and how to play HEVC videos in Chrome without issues. Often shortened to just streaming, livestreaming is the process of transmitting media 'live' to computers and devices. We don't care about going rewinding or fast forward, just showing the last image produced, as fast as possible. 264 video codec when possible Transcoding h. The video is encoded as a H. I can't find any web player that can do that. I suspect there might be issues related to browser compatibility or the way I'm handling the H. com or the hls. Apr 14, 2020 · According to html5test. Jan 16, 2021 · Firefox 4 can't play live video stream from PGA. The application is based on picamera and tornado. If you’re seeing transcoding then you’re going to need to provide more details. 264 stream inside a fragmented MPEG4 container that is Media Source Extensions (MSE) compatible, so that it can be received by modern web browsers with minimal client-side buffering. Introduce slight delays in the stream using regular JavaScript. ActiveX video controls on IE are rarely All modern browsers don't natively support playback of RTSP (Real Time Streaming Protocol) streams, which is a common format for many popular IP cameras. Chrome has since stopped providing support for this codec. 264 and converting video formats for broader browser compatibility, what are the trade-offs involved in terms of video quality, file size, and the overall viewing experience? Most people, like me, are going to assume you accidentally typed H. On the exit I have H. 264 video in browsers using modern techniques such as WebRTC and Video. 264 video directly in your Google Chrome browser. To install it you can just: download the code unpack it to a folder of your choosing enable developer mode in edge click load unpacked extension point to the folder you unpacked the code into I Oct 3, 2025 · MPEG-4/H. I have found a lot of examples showing how to stream a video file to rtmp stream. This is a fairly complex and nascent subject with a lot of variables, so in this article Dec 4, 2017 · Software engineer and consultant with >15 years experience. 264 files in VLC? Learn how to play, view and open H. Oct 12, 2025 · 2. 264 is commonly hardware accelerated by GPUs, which usually means smoother video playback and reduced CPU usage. In this situation, a standard video player or browser can't fix it. 264 videos instead of VP8/VP9 videos. 264 video stream and I want to watch it without VLC media player and etc. 264 data into the web browser, using which ever protocol there is? That's all we want. 264 and I still can’t view the feed. May 18, 2023 · This tutorial will show you how to stream your webcam to your browser with the lowest latency possible, utilizing RTSP and WebRTC. 265/HEVC support. 264 stream using mpegts and then vlc is used as a server May 8, 2025 · The Restreamer works by: Pulling the RTSP stream from your IP camera Maintaining the native H. What I want to achieve is to push raw h264 frames over websocket, and leave the fragmentation on the browser itsel Feb 15, 2025 · Streaming video and audio has never been more accessible, thanks to powerful tools like FFmpeg and robust protocols such as RTSP. H264 (H. Is there an App (free or paid) or a browser extension (Safari / Chrome) that will playback H264 encoded files on the latest iPad Pro? I have already… Apr 1, 2025 · Use a browser that supports hardware or software HEVC decoding. 265 format for the video. Add an H. 264 Video and AAC Audio With NPAPI support gone in Chrome & Firefox, I can no longer use the handy VLC plugin to natively play everything above. 265. 265 connections. 264 support. Feb 14, 2020 · I would like to play a h264 stream in html5 (mse) which comes from a live camera. Stream should be available from different devices such as PC, tablet, smartphone in this way I will use only browser. Learn how to stream RTSP H. It will provide the best quality and In contrast, H. We support Chrome for Web Broadcast. Once I fully wrapped my head around how beneficial that could be, I sat down and wrote a simple application to leverage it. Before reading further make sure you’ve watched our Interface Overview slideshow and familiarized yourself with the interface. Oct 11, 2018 · I'm trying to stream my video into h264, so I can play it on a html5 page through video tag. And further down in Video codecs (under Streaming) they have MP4 with H. 1/8/7 and Lower To play H264, you need a powerful H264 file player with H. 265 encoding on the client side. I’ve tried switching it to H. Android, Firefox, Chrome, IE, Safari (Mac OS and iOS)), and Nov 28, 2023 · This can be because you don’t have the latest version of the Microsoft Edge browser installed. e. 264 Video and AC3 Audio, or H. The overlay is added using WebGPU and WGSL. Add an overlay to the bottom right part of the video that encodes the frame’s timestamp. Adjust your camera settings to use a different codec if possible: Go to Media > Video > Steam and change the codec of the stream you are trying to visualize to H. The goal is to Direct Play all media. I read that JWPlayer is capable of doing that, but only in th Aug 4, 2022 · My security camera provides frames in H264 codec via RTSP. NOTE: I have both extensions (for HEVC and for HEIC) from store already installed but seems the new Edge ignore them. js demo app with an HEVC HLS stream. 1. 264 not playing in VLC. 264 streams. Oct 11, 2025 · "Can I use" provides up-to-date browser support tables for support of front-end web technologies on desktop and mobile web browsers. h264ify makes YouTube stream H. For example, I've been using the free H. 264 :) Good luck! UPD2: I actually took and encoded the file Feb 18, 2020 · A few weeks back I came across a JavaScript github repo called jMuxer, that would take raw h. 264 codec files on VLC from your PC and Mac from this step-by-step guide. Can’t play MP4 videos in Chrome If your Chrome browser shows this video is either unavailable or not supported in this browser while you are trying to play MP4 videos, it means the video was encoded with the h264. Play your videos in JavaScript. Apr 12, 2025 · Access powerful and secure free online H264 tools to convert, view, edit, merge, split, and compare H264 files — all without installing any software. 265 and that isn’t going to change due to licensing fees. Our tools support the . Jun 11, 2017 · I am using ffmpeg and vlc on linux to produce MPEG transport stream (mpegts) over HTTP. Nov 22, 2023 · Despite my efforts, the video player doesn't seem to play the H. For more information, please refer to the following document: Apr 7, 2016 · Play live feeds of H264 on all three browsers. 264 works fine. A JavaScript implementation of a full H264 video decoder that supports main profile. So for a long time if you wanted to display your RTSP IP camera stream on the web page, you had to use intermediate transcoding servers, which Oct 2, 2017 · 3 Streaming over UDP, I have an MPEG Transport Stream containing either: MPEG-2 Video and MPEG-1 Audio, or H. Learn how to enable H. This service can receive RTSP/H264 video stream from an IP Camera and can broadcast it to the Hello fellow edge users, if you would like to watch h265/hevc videos natively in your browser you can use this extension to do so. 264 Video and MPEG-1 Audio, or H. Below is my C++ code with FFMPEG library getting frames from from the camera. Specializing in product engineering, design systems, and full-stack web development with React and TypeScript. 264 encoder to convert my video files to H. 264 support as well. 265/HEVC compatibility. For testing HEVC browser support, use the “Unprefixed tests” from caniuse. 264 from a Raspberry Pi equiped with a V1, V2, or HQ camera module, directly to a browser. I tried many third party h264 decoders in JavaScript and each one has its own iss H264 live player using jMuxerIf it does not play automatically, Click the `video play button` to initiate the video See full list on github. Sep 28, 2017 · So, is it possible to simply stream raw h. Oct 7, 2013 · I am currently using Unreal Media Server, which allows me to view TS files (h264 & AAC-LC) as well as the WMV, mpeg-2 in a browser perfectly, but one platform we deliver to required a TS with h264 and AAC-HEv1, which Unreal struggles with, it won’t play the audio, so I’ve been hunting for other solutions. To get started, download Desktop Video 11. Newer versions of Edge support playback of H. Aside from Safari, no browser supports H. What I'm trying to avoid Using FFMPEG or VLC to transcode and stream H264 to MJPEG, which would still only work for Chrome and Firefox. The most popular streaming codec is probably libx264, though if you're streaming to a device which requires a "crippled" baseline h264 implementation, you can use the x264 "baseline" profile. Notes Chrome does not accept plugins. This means the container, video, audio and subtitles are all compatible with the client. Mar 14, 2023 · Process video frames to turn them into black and white using pure JavaScript. 265-encoded stream correctly. 264 video format Browser Compatibility On Microsoft Edge mpeg 4 is a standard for video compression, it is also the most widely used format in handheld devices. The videos there should play if your browser supports H. Aug 14, 2014 · 5 I have transcoded each frame of my video from RGB -> YUV12 -> H264. I did check some links on web, They recommend to play the video in Transcode & Play RTSP Video Streams in Browser. com Descript's h264 Player lets you seamlessly play high-quality h264 videos directly in your browser. Feb 7, 2018 · I want to create a webpage with a video player that can play a H264 mpeg-ts live stream. Meaning Flash or other plugin based solutions will not work. It’s not easy to display live video stream from an IP camera on a web page because you need wide internet bandwidth and a great video player that is compatible with the major browsers. 2. Jan 23, 2021 · I want to create a webpage with a video player that can play a (H264 - MPEG4 - AVC) live stream and the URL of streaming video doesn't include format in the end of URL. If the media is incompatible for any reason, Jellyfin will use FFmpeg to convert the media to a format that the client can process. Jan 20, 2019 · Howto – Stream HTML5 video – H264 encoded video encapsulated in MP4 from the Raspberry Pi to any web browser At the time of writing I’m developing a Bootstrap/Web interface for the Raspberry Pi camera module, to transform a Raspberry Pi into an easily configurable IP Camera. Dec 5, 2019 · I'm looking for a solution to play raw h264 stream coming from a native server through WebSocket live on a browser. You need a specialized tool designed for file Aug 14, 2023 · One more: Considering the use of alternative codecs like H. 264 and mux it in browser, so that it could be played with a standard video tag via media source extensions. Compared with playing normal H264 video, it is a challenging thing to play H264 video footage from CCTV cameras and other security cameras. Windows Media Foundation and FFMPEG sample code for streaming an application window to a web browser. But fortunately there are some cloud based services that can do this job for us. Whether you’re building a live streaming application or setting up a surveillance system, this guide will walk you through everything you need to know—from understanding the need for an RTSP server to using FFmpeg for a variety of streaming scenarios, including HLS. 264 when you meant H. If the video codec is unsupported, this will Dec 16, 2024 · To Wrap Things Up How to Play H264 in VLC Owing to its good compression efficiency, H264 is widely used in streaming services, broadcasting, security cameras, and mobile devices. js. Sep 25, 2025 · Stuck in playing H. Direct play of H. 264 and H. Read on and learn how to solve H. Whether you're setting up a security camera feed or integrating live video I need to stream live h. Use the IE mode in the edge browser: This will allow the use of the IE plugin which can manage H. com?? Update Firefox to prevent add-ons issues from root certificate expiration Jun 24, 2025 · Livestreaming web audio and video Livestreaming technology is often employed to relay live events such as sports, concerts and more generally TV and Radio programmes that are output live. TypeScript utility to process H264 profile-level-id values webrtc rtp h264 browser nodejs Mar 21, 2024 · This post summarizes common solutions to the VLC H. h264 file in browser, Trying to accomplish this using html video tags. What I came up with Apr 7, 2015 · I am trying to play . std::string read_frame() { AVPacket *packet; packet= Pi H264 To Browser is a simple Python application designed to stream hardware encoded h. Direct Stream will occur if the audio, container or subtitles happen to not be supported. S. Perfect for content creators and developers, it ensures smooth playback and easy integration into any project, enhancing your video experience with minimal effort. 264 when needed Converting AAC audio to Opus for browser compatibility Delivering the converted stream over WebRTC with minimal processing overhead Advanced Capability: Handling Multiple Camera Streams Feb 1, 2017 · Direct RTSP streaming is still not supported by browsers, if you have to play an RTSP stream in the browser then you need a proxy server that will convert RTSP to HTTP stream. Windows 10's default web browser has changed from Internet Explorer to Microsoft Edge. Play MJPEG feeds on IE. The only solution is to change to another codec like H264-MPEG-4 AVC. Jan 2, 2025 · Powerful H264 Video Player for Windows 11/10/8. Stream H264 to browsers with websocket and w3 media source extensions - elsampsa/websocket-mse-demo Jun 13, 2025 · Fixing Corrupt Files When Chrome Won't Play Videos If you've tried all the browser-based fixes and the video still won't play—especially if it's a file you downloaded—the video file itself is likely damaged or corrupted. 264 Encoded Video File) file extension and run smoothly in any modern browser. 265 streams in the browser with Shinobi and maintain low CPU use Due to changes in browser standards RTSP streams are no longer directly playable in most browsers, so we use … May 20, 2010 · If the browser coughs it up, and doesn't want to play it (remember to check it with Chrome or Safari), then you can just convert the file using one of the free encoders on the net. 265 to h. lbtc enxgrb hpi jsax zhkzvw exadxo qpp ndabu jwfm picap rgboqx mgxrux slux ami beie